Question

question 3 of 10
what is the distance between the points (2, 1) and (14, 6) on a coordinate plane?

a. 12 units
b. 14 units
c. 5 units
d. 13 units

Explanation:

Step1: Recall distance formula

The distance \(d\) between two points \((x_1,y_1)\) and \((x_2,y_2)\) is \(d = \sqrt{(x_2 - x_1)^2+(y_2 - y_1)^2}\).

Step2: Identify coordinates

Here, \(x_1 = 2\), \(y_1 = 1\), \(x_2 = 14\), \(y_2 = 6\).

Step3: Substitute into formula

Calculate \(x_2 - x_1 = 14 - 2 = 12\) and \(y_2 - y_1 = 6 - 1 = 5\).
Then, \(d=\sqrt{(12)^2+(5)^2}=\sqrt{144 + 25}=\sqrt{169}\).

Step4: Simplify the square root

\(\sqrt{169}=13\).

Answer:

D. 13 units
